Mercury Prize-winning and BRIT Award-winning UK jazz collective Ezra Collective return with their new single and music video, “Jubilee Feeling,” ahead of their highly anticipated album Here Because of Hope, set for release on 11 September 2026. Led by drummer and bandleader Femi Koleoso, the London five-piece have become a defining force in contemporary jazz, celebrated for their genre-fluid sound that draws from jazz, Afrobeat, hip-hop, soul and UK dance music.
The release follows Ezra Collective’s debut appearance at the Montreux Jazz Festival Franschhoek earlier this year, where the collective introduced their high-energy live sound to South African audiences. Blending the harmonic language of UK jazz with the euphoric energy of 2010s Funky House, “Jubilee Feeling” is a vibrant celebration of London’s Black musical culture, anchored by Joe Armon-Jones’ dynamic piano performance.
For Koleoso, the concept of Jubilee is deeply personal: “Jubilee is a word that means a great deal to me. It’s connected to the church where I grew up and the youth group I work with, but beyond that, its meaning really resonates with me – a time when debts are cleared, prisoners are released and people are given the chance to begin again. I see it as a kind of equalisation, a moment of celebration and a fresh start.”
The accompanying music video, directed by Ebeneza Blanche and filmed in London, draws inspiration from early-2000s British nightlife and rave culture, with styling and visuals that evoke the era’s distinctive club scene. The visual follows the energy and unpredictability of a night out, placing the band’s jazz sensibilities against a contemporary club backdrop.
Speaking about the visual, Koleoso says: “We wanted the video to capture that tension – the look and atmosphere feel rooted in the early 2000s, while the music is completely fresh. Nights out can take you in unexpected directions, but often lead to that incredible moment of shared happiness – that’s the Jubilee Feeling.”
The forthcoming Here Because of Hope explores the movement of Black music from West Africa through the Caribbean and into Britain, reflecting how these sounds have travelled, evolved and influenced generations.
